> Howdy,
>
> If you have several transit providers connected to your network and much =
of your traffic is generally directed by the "BGP tiebreaker" (i.e. lowest =
IP address) is there a way, without specifying on a per-prefix basis to pre=
fer the "tie breaker winner" slightly less often? I don't want to "complete=
ly flip" the preference so that it just saturates a different link, I am ju=
st trying to see if there is any good way to influence the "natural" select=
ion method.
>
> We have 6 transit providers, and Level3 always wins because it is 4/8, no=
rmally this isn't a problem because we have traffic engineering systems (ro=
ute science/avaya) which move traffic away from that link, but if we need t=
o reboot the RS, or something catastrophic happens we would like it to spre=
ad out a little more evenly.
>
> Anyone have any thoughts on this?
